Nuovo Espresso is the updated version of the classic Espresso coursebook series for learners of Italian as a foreign language. The B1 level (intermediate) is aimed at students who have completed A2 and want to reach the "threshold" level—capable of handling everyday situations, expressing opinions, and understanding main points on familiar topics.

Title: A Modern Classic for Italian Learners, But Bring a Partner

Rating: ★★★★☆ (4/5)

If you are walking into an Italian language school anywhere in Europe right now, chances are high you will be handed a copy of Nuovo Espresso 1. Having worked through the PDF version of this book, it is easy to see why it is the industry standard—but it isn’t without a few quirks.

The Good: The biggest strength of Nuovo Espresso is its "story-based" approach. Unlike dry textbooks from decades past that have you conjugating verbs in isolation, this book follows a continuous narrative of five friends living in Rome. It feels less like studying and more like following a sitcom. The PDF format is fantastic for portability; I could study on my tablet during my commute without lugging a heavy text around. The Not-So-Good: This is fundamentally a classroom book. If you are a self-learner relying solely on the PDF, you might struggle. The instructions are in Italian (immersion style), and while the grammar tables at the back are clear, the book often assumes a teacher is there to explain the nuances. Also, be aware that the PDF version can sometimes be a "scan" depending on where you acquire it, meaning you cannot always select text to translate it easily.

The Verdict: Nuovo Espresso 1 is a vibrant, modern tool that makes Italian feel alive. However, if you are buying the PDF for self-study, I highly recommend pairing it with a grammar workbook or a tutor to fill in the gaps that the "immersion" method leaves open.
